Figure 5. AOP2 Transcript Alters Metabolic Profiles, Content, and Gene Expression.

Figure 5

Wild-type Col-0 that is null for AOP2 and AOP3 was modified through the introduction of a functional AOP2 transcript from B. oleracea. All glucosinolate abbreviations are as described in Table S1.

(A) HPLC profile of aliphatic glucosinolates detected in foliar tissue of wild-type Col-0.

(B) HPLC profile of aliphatic glucosinolates detected in foliar tissue of Col-0 containing the functional AOP2 transcript.

(C) Average total foliar aliphatic glucosinolate content in Col-0 and Col-0::AOP2 is shown with standard error bars. Six plants per genotype were measured for total aliphatic glucosinolate content within an experiment, and the experiment was conducted twice to provide 32 total measurements. **p < 0.0001 as determined by ANOVA.

(D) Percentage increase in transcript levels in Col-0::AOP2 as compared with Col-0 is presented. RNA from 3 plants per genotype were individually hybridized to ATH1 Affymetrix arrays to obtain transcript levels for the aliphatic glucosinolate genes. ANOVA was used to test for significant differences between the two genotypes for the glucosinolate biosynthetic and regulatory genes via ANOVA with a false discovery rate of 0.05. Gray bars show transcripts significantly increased by the introduction of the AOP2 transcript. Nonsignificant changes are shown in white bars.
